(1)chm文件和MSDN无法打开
下午不知卸载了啥,导致chm文件打不开,MSDN也打不开,报错“Can't Open C:/Program Files/Microsoft Visual Studio/MSDN/2001OCT/1033/MSDN130.COL”。看了这篇博文,在命令行运行regsvr32 itss.dll,之后就行了。记下备忘。
(2)无法从VS中用F1打开MSDN
昨天以为万事大吉了,谁知今天当尝试使用 F1 或帮助菜单从 Visual Studio 程序中访问“MSDN Library 帮助”时,显示以下错误信息:unable to display help
在这里找到了解决办法:注册Vshelp.dll
a)搜索 Vshelp.dll。
b)选择开始,然后单击运行。键入 Regsvr32。
c)单击并按住在搜索中找到的文件 Vshelp.dll,并将其拖到运行框中(紧随 Regsvr32 之后)。单击确定。
(3)MSDN中索引和搜索功能失效
多灾多难的我,解决了上面两个问题之后,又惊诧的发现MSDN的索引和搜索功能失效了:索引下是一片空白,搜索任何东西都是未找到相关主题。之后发现所有的chm文件的索引和搜索功能都这样了,就连连记事本的帮助也一样,关掉以后还出现程序错误。
之后卸载/重装了n次MSDN都不行,最后还是在优快云的博客上找到了解决办法:
regsvr32 hhctrl.ocx
regsvr32 itss.dll
regsvr32 itircl.dll //这个很重要,是关于全文搜索的。

本文介绍了遇到的三个问题及其解决方案:1)CHM文件及MSDN无法打开;2)从VS中无法通过F1打开MSDN;3)MSDN中的索引和搜索功能失效。针对这些问题,提供了具体的步骤来注册相关的dll文件,如itss.dll、Vshelp.dll和hhctrl.ocx等。
1627

被折叠的 条评论
为什么被折叠?



